- The distance between Cita/ Kadala, Russia and Washington, In, Usa is approximately 9,695 km or 6,024 mi.
- To reach Cita/ Kadala in this distance one would set out from Washington, In bearing 347.6°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Cita/ Kadala bearing 195.8° or SSW .
- Cita/ Kadala has a boreal subarctic climate with dry winters (Dwc) whereas Washington, In has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Cita/ Kadala is in or near the boreal moist forest biome whereas Washington, In is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 15.8 °C (28.4°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 17.4 °C (31.3°F) more in Cita/ Kadala.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 774.8 mm (30.5 in) less which is equivalent to 774.8 l/m² (19.02 US gal/ft²) or 7,748,000 l/ha (828,313 US gal/ac) less. About 1/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 13.1° lower in Cita/ Kadala than in Washington, In.
